Abstract:
Primary care of girls between the ages of 10 and 20 presents some unique challenges. This article presents a review of normal adolescent development and explores preventive health issues and some of the more common acute medical problems of adolescent girls. Counseling on some behavioral and psychosocial issues also is discussed. Finally, anticipatory guidance topics to be discussed with parents are included.
